Hey Good Loc'n

Whitney Foreman is the CEO and Founder of Hey Good Loc'n, a brand rooted in passion, culture, and authenticity. Her journey began in 2018 as a loc enthusiast, embracing her own personal loc journey. What started as self-expression quickly evolved into purpose, leading her behind the chair as a dedicated loctician.

Committed to her craft, Whitney continuously invested in her education, staying informed, refined, and aligned with the evolving practices of loc care. Through her work, she built more than styles, she created experiences centered around identity, confidence, and honoring the beauty of black culture.

In 2024 Whitney retired from behind the chair, choosing to expand her impact in a new way. Today, she curates intentional experiences and events that celebrate the beauty, soul, and richness of Black culture creating spaces where community, creativity, and culture can be fully expressed and embraced.
